Mertensia lanceolata

Description Images

Authors: DC.   Pursh  

Botanical Description

Height 10-20cm. Leaves bluish-green, lanceolate, hairy. Stems unbranched with flowers in a loose cluster, blue, 5-10mm long, the limb of the corolla longer than, or equal to, the tube, the anthers projecting from the throat. Rocky Mountains at lower altitudes in open situations.
